Make support for CRAM-MD5 authentication method for SMTP communication

Currently Domino supports only AUTH LOGIN as an authentication method for SMTP communication. It would be great id safer mathod like CRAM-MD5 would be also supported.

    We are using a mailflow as follows from our [ERP-System] --> [Domino Server 14.0] --> [smtp.office365.com] and use Basic Authentication with username and password. This has been working without any problems for several years.

    Now with the recent announcement for the retirement of Microsoft Basic Authentication for relay of e-mails in favour of OAUTH 2 as described in the Microsoft Note https://techcommunity.microsoft.com/blog/exchange/exchange-online-to-retire-basic-auth-for-client-submission-smtp-auth/4114750.

    We need to be able to continue relaying e-mails but we can't - this is a show-stopper for us. Here I think HCL needs to put efforts in a solution for this oncoming scenario that can be managed in the Administrator Client or a bolt-on separate process that runs on the server catering for e-mail relay to office365.
